About company
HSBC is a global banking and financial services powerhouse, serving millions of customers worldwide.
You’ll find a diverse range of financial solutions, from personal banking to investment services. As you explore HSBC, you’ll notice a commitment to sustainability and community investment, which sets it apart from other institutions.
With a presence in over 60 countries, HSBC connects people and businesses across borders, making it a leader in international finance.
The company values innovation and adaptability, ensuring you’re always at the forefront of financial trends.
This global reach and strong values create a dynamic environment for anyone looking to grow their career.

How to apply step by step
To apply for a position at HSBC, start by visiting their careers page, where you can explore various job openings that match your skills and interests.
Follow these steps to streamline your application process:
- Create an account on the HSBC careers portal.
- Upload your updated resume and cover letter.
- Complete the online application form with accurate details.
- Prepare for assessments or interviews by researching HSBC’s values and culture.
- Keep track of your application status through your account dashboard.
